Each teacher in the English/foreign language department at Southside High School recently recognized students for academic achievement, effort, and/or attitude.
Students recognized were Shacora Wiggins (Spanish II-Susan Moore), Zakiya Bryant (English II Honors-Meredith Southworth), Latequa Brown (English IV-Connie Lewis), Will Mumford (Composition-Freda Potter), Geniquia Keyes (Composition-Kathy Macey), and James Jones (English III-Grace Morgan).
Pictures of these students were displayed on the department’s “Reach for the Stars” bulletin board.
Pictured (standing) are James Jones and (seated left to right) Zakiya Bryant, Shacora Wiggins, and Geniquia Keyes. Latequa Brown and Will Mumford are not pictured
